XML 50 R40.htm IDEA: XBRL DOCUMENT v3.23.2
Property and Equipment, Net - Property and Equipment, Net (Detail) - USD ($)
$ in Thousands
Jun. 30, 2023
Dec. 31, 2022
Property, Plant and Equipment [Line Items]    
Property, plant and equipment, gross $ 396,588 $ 371,479
Less accumulated depreciation (196,263) (196,468)
Property, plant and equipment, net 200,325 175,011
Land and Improvements [Member]    
Property, Plant and Equipment [Line Items]    
Property, plant and equipment, gross 20,961 19,609
Buildings and Improvements [Member]    
Property, Plant and Equipment [Line Items]    
Property, plant and equipment, gross 113,227 102,245
Machinery, Equipment and Aircraft [Member]    
Property, Plant and Equipment [Line Items]    
Property, plant and equipment, gross 221,861 218,549
Construction in Progress [Member]    
Property, Plant and Equipment [Line Items]    
Property, plant and equipment, gross $ 40,540 $ 31,076